The size of Tamban is approximately 66.6 square kilometres. There are 4 parks, covering nearly 57.9% of the total area. The population of Tamban in 2016 was 92 people. By 2021 the population was 94 showing a population growth of 2.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tamban is 60-69 years. Households in Tamban are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tamban work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 78.90% of the homes in Tamban were owner-occupied compared with 90.30% in 2016.
